In 1991, Joseph Viszmeg, an Edmonton filmmaker, was diagnosed with a rare form of adrenal cancer which was already spreading to other organs. Doctors called him terminally ill, with perhaps a year to live. Four years later, Joseph Viszmeg is very much alive, In My Own Time is his personal account of living with this disease. The film gives a rare opportunity to experience the ever-changing reality of Joseph Viszmeg. Determination, gentle humour, firm courage and hope prevail. One man's remarkable story of life challenges us to examine the very basics of human existence. Who am I? What is the purpose of my life? What would I do in similar circumstances? This film is about the power of healing that lies within us all.
